Timing Follows Reported Super Bowl Breakup

The concert outburst arrives approximately one month after sources indicated the celebrity couple had parted ways. According to multiple reports, the separation occurred just days before Diggs and the New England Patriots suffered their Super Bowl defeat against the Seattle Seahawks on February 8th.

Insiders have suggested that friends encouraged Cardi B to end the relationship after what they perceived as repeated betrayals by the football player. "Her friends have been trying to show her that he is not right for her and that she deserved better," a source revealed to Us Weekly last month.

The rapper reportedly now feels "free" and has returned to the dating scene, actively "putting herself out there again" according to those close to her.

Earlier Signs Pointed to Relationship Trouble

Observers noted potential trouble in the relationship when Cardi B delivered an unusually brief and frosty message to Diggs before the Super Bowl. When approached by an ESPN reporter requesting an inspiring message for the athlete, the rapper offered only a curt "Good luck" before walking away without further comment.

Further evidence emerged when Cardi B shared Instagram content recapping her Super Bowl experience without mentioning Diggs or his team's disappointing loss. Instead, she posted footage of herself dancing during the game and participating in Bad Bunny's halftime show surprise appearances.

Complex Family Dynamics Add to Turbulence

The relationship developed against a backdrop of complicated family circumstances for both individuals. Diggs welcomed daughter Charliee Harper with Aileen Lopera in April, followed by two additional children with other women. Lopera recently withdrew a paternity and child support lawsuit after DNA testing confirmed Diggs as the father.

Meanwhile, Cardi B gave birth to her first child with Diggs in November 2025, shortly after the couple publicly confirmed their relationship. The rapper previously filed for divorce from ex-husband Offset in July 2024 and shares three children with him: seven-year-old Kulture, four-year-old Wave, and one-year-old Blossom.

The couple had been romantically linked since early last year before making their relationship public in May when photographed together courtside at a New York Knicks basketball game. Their separation now adds another layer to what has been a particularly turbulent period for both celebrities.
